MEMORY LEAK BF6
Hello everyone,
I'm dealing with an annoying FPS drop issue in Battlefield 6 and I’m hoping someone can help me figure it out.
🖥️ My specs:
- GPU: NVIDIA RTX 5060 (8GB VRAM)
- CPU: Intel i5-14400F
- RAM: 32 GB DDR5
- OS: Windows 11 PRO 64-bit
- NVIDIA driver: 581.57 WHQL (latest Game Ready)
⚙️ What happens:
When I start playing, I get amazing performance — around 300–400 FPS on High settings (1080p).
After playing 2–3 matches, my FPS slowly drops to around 150–200 and stays there until I restart the game.
🔍 What I noticed:
- GPU usage stays high (~95–98%)
- VRAM usage keeps going up during matches (from ~6 GB to 7.2–7.4 GB)
- Temperatures are fine (~65°C)
- Restarting the game instantly brings performance back to normal
✅ What I tried:
- Cleared shader cache with DDU
- Verified game files in EA App
- Reinstalled the game
- Disabled overlays and background apps
💭 My guess:
It feels like some kind of VRAM memory leak or caching issue — performance keeps dropping the longer I play.
